The races for the vice-presidential slots of the ruling All Progressives Congress is still ongoing while the Borno State Youths and Students Forum have endorsed the candidature of Senator Kashim Shettima as the running mate of the All Progressives Congress (APC) presidential candidate, Bola Tinubu.
The forum described Tinubu as a formidable force that can match the presidential candidates of other political parties in the 2023 general elections, particularly the PDP Presidential candidate, Atiku Abubakar.
The Chairman of the Forum, Comrade Mahmud Muhammad who stated this in a press statement made available to newsmen in Bauchi State said that the APC Convention was a huge success, adding that the best presidential candidate emerged because only he can be a match for Atiku Abubakar, the presidential candidate of the opposition People Democratic Party
He stated that ever since the emergence of the National leader of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) and former Governor of Lagos State,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u as the Presidential Candidate of the party, the issue of who becomes the vice presidential running mate has flooded the pages of Newspapers and other media with different interpretations and permutations thereby heating the polity.
According to him, Bola Tinubu has consistently remained active in the political arena of Nigeria and has won elections both as Senator and two terms as Governor of Lagos State.

“It is an inarguable, undeniable discourse that the region is suffering from power drought and dissertation for the past 62 years and the last time the region tasted or smelled the corridor of power was when Atiku served as the Vice President from 1999 to 2007” he stressed.
Mahmud Muhammad stated that the region has suffered since 2009 from the activities of Boko Haram insurgents, pointing out that the country needs visionary leadership to support the Governors of the region in peace-building through stakeholders and community enhancements.
“This is the reason why out of all mentioned, only Senator Kashim Shetima stands out. It is for the above-mentioned reasons that as a son of the North East region, fingers Senator Kashim Shetima whose success in Government and as a seasoned banker deserves to be the Vice President of Nigeria to facilitate the Bola Tinubu’s vision of transforming Nigeria into the world-class economy”.
